Substrate Safe Mode是什么怎么样
在区块链技术领域,Substrate框架因其灵活性和可扩展性而备受关注。作为Polkadot生态系统的基石之一,Substrate为开发者提供了构建自定义区块链的强大工具。然而,在复杂的开发过程中,难免会遇到各种问题或紧急情况。这时,“Safe Mode”(安全模式)便成为了一个重要的功能。
Substrate Safe Mode的基本概念
Substrate Safe Mode是一种应急机制,旨在帮助开发者在区块链运行出现问题时快速恢复系统稳定性。它允许节点在特定条件下进入一种受限的操作状态,从而避免因错误配置或恶意攻击导致的进一步损害。简单来说,Safe Mode就像是区块链世界的“保险丝”,能够在关键时刻保护网络免受严重故障的影响。
Safe Mode的核心作用
1. 防止数据损坏
当某些关键组件出现异常时,Safe Mode会自动隔离这些部分,确保其他正常工作的模块不受影响。这有助于减少潜在的数据丢失或损坏风险。
2. 简化问题排查
在Safe Mode下,系统会屏蔽不必要的复杂操作,使开发者能够专注于诊断和修复核心问题。这种简化的环境有助于加快问题解决的速度。
3. 保障用户资产安全
对于公共区块链而言,用户资产的安全至关重要。Safe Mode可以在极端情况下冻结某些交易,直到问题得到妥善处理,从而最大限度地保护用户的利益。
如何启用Safe Mode?
启用Safe Mode通常需要通过命令行接口进行操作。具体步骤可能包括:
- 检查当前节点的状态;
- 输入特定的指令以激活Safe Mode;
- 根据提示完成后续设置。
需要注意的是,Safe Mode并不是默认开启的功能,只有在必要时才会被手动触发。此外,不同版本的Substrate可能会有不同的实现细节,因此建议参考官方文档获取最新指南。
总结
Substrate Safe Mode是区块链开发中的一项重要功能,它不仅增强了系统的容错能力,还为开发者提供了更多的安全保障。随着区块链技术的不断发展,类似这样的创新功能将继续推动整个行业的进步。对于希望深入了解Substrate及其应用的读者而言,掌握Safe Mode的相关知识无疑是一个不错的起点。
希望这篇文章符合您的需求!如果有任何修改意见或其他问题,请随时告诉我。